Frost Bank and Cardtronics have announced an ATM branding relationship that will extend fee-free access who use ATMs at Valero Corner Stores. The program covers 615 ATMs located at Valero convenience stores in Texas, and will take effect by August 15.
With the agreement, Frost, an FI with 115 locations across Texas, will more than double its count of on-us ATMs. Added to the 469 ATMs Frost currently operates, the Valero ATMs will boost the bank's network total in Texas to 1,084. The Valero stores will extend Frost ATM access to 131 communities where Frost does not have a physical presence — including college towns Bryan/College Station, Waco and Lubbock.
"This partnership brings together three Texas-based companies — Frost, Cardtronics and Valero — in a move that significantly expands the number of ATMs our customers can use free of charge. We are making it easier for our customers to do business with us by giving them more access to their money," said Frost chairman and CEO, Dick Evans. "It significantly broadens our network of ATMs across all of our regions, giving Frost the third-largest number of ATMs in Texas."
"By forming this ATM branding relationship with Cardtronics, Frost validates our belief that Cardtronics ATMs can play an important role in connecting consumers with their financial institutions, creating convenient cash access in destination retail locations," said Rick Updyke, president of the U.S. business group at Cardtronics.
